== Background ==
Tyler Joseph has spoken several times about the track, including:
Tyler has spoken about how he was feeling when writing “Holding On To You” when he did a live performance for SiriusXM. Here he revealed that he was in doubt about continuing making music, but because he was excited about writing this song, he continued to pursue music. "People try to interpret what the song is saying and in a way I feel like I’m supposed to let that live and not answer the question. In short, there was a particular show that I was playing and at this time we were really able talk to everyone after a show. I remember this show in particular more than usual, kids came up to me and felt like they needed to share what it was they were going through and a lot of what they were going through had to do with suicide… thank goodness it had a lot to do with them overcoming it and using music and using songs, in particular my songs, to help them get over that and I was so inspired and so moved by that show and those kids that came up to me and shared with me their struggles with suicide and this song is very inspired by them and those people that struggle with that. I don’t claim to be a professional opinion on the topic because it’s dangerous to talk about suicide and to claim you have a voice on the issue but this song is about taking that negative energy and aiming it at something else, not aiming it at yourself, really giving these kids the power to know that they do have control over their circumstances." |“Holding on to You” was originally featured on ''Regional At Best'' (2011) and was later remastered for ''Vessel'' (2013). It is the first single the band released under a record label.
Tyler Joseph via ''Rock Sound'':<blockquote>"To have “Holding on to You” kind of be the focus track makes sense to me.</blockquote>It does stand in the middle of what to expect from us – having to do with a lot of different genres, the melody in this song is digestible and it’s one of my favourite chord progressions I’ve ever done. I like that the chorus only happens twice in the song which is a big no no! You are supposed to do it four or five times especially if you want to see a lot of success and have your songs on Super Bowl commercials."
